Tips to meet people at social events
You can make more friends at one party by showing interest in them than in a month by trying to meet people online. Meeting new people and making genuine connections in local events can be fun and easy if you go with the right mindset.
When it comes to meeting new people, nothing beats showing up in the real world. But none of the tips will work if you are not coming from the right place. Keep an open mind when attending social events. Reframe strangers as potential friends, it will make it much easier to approach conversations and fully engage in them.
When choosing an event, keep an eye on interesting themes, something you can relate to. Meeting new people in the context of mutual interest increases your chances of being friends.
Research events with the types of people you want to meet. They could be people in your age group, your field of work, or a specific neighborhood. Do not be too strict though, loosen up a little bit from your expectations.
Go where people are intentionally looking to make friends such as networking events where it feels normal and expected to walk up and introduce yourself.
